AUTHOR=Juang Horng-Heng , Chen Shao-Ming , Lin Gigin , Chiang Meng-Han , Hou Chen-Pang , Lin Yu-Hsiang , Yang Pei-Shan , Chang Phei-Lang , Chen Chien-lun , Lin Kuo-Yen , Tsui Ke-Hung TITLE=The Clinical Experiences of Urine Metabolomics of Genitourinary Urothelial Cancer in a Tertiary Hospital in Taiwan JOURNAL=Frontiers in Oncology VOLUME=Volume 11 - 2021 YEAR=2021 URL=https://www.frontiersin.org/journals/oncology/articles/10.3389/fonc.2021.680910 DOI=10.3389/fonc.2021.680910 ISSN=2234-943X ABSTRACT=There are only a few studies have addressed the impact of diagnostic urine metabolites and clinical outcomes associated with genitourinaryurothelial(GU)cancer up till this date.Furthermore, the longitudinal analysis of the dynamics of urine metabolites contributing to the detection of GUcancer has not yet been fully investigated;therefore, the discovery of novel diagnostic urine biomarkers is of our enormous interest. We explored the correlation of the urine metabolomics profiles to the GU cancers. The aqueous metabolites of the GU cancerand thecontrol were also identified and analyzed through high-resolution1H nuclear magnetic resonance (NMR) spectroscopy. Compared with the control, the urine metabolites of the tumor were studied in relation to changes over time in a linear mixed model for repeated measures.The urine metabolomof eighty-two (58 males and 24 female) patients with GU cancersweresystemically analyzed.The urine metabolite profile in GU cancer was significantly higher than those in the control group (p<0.05). Sevenurine metabolitesincludinghistidine, propylene glycol, valine, leucine, acetylsalicylate, glycine and isoleucineas well asother pathways were identifiedstatistically significantly associated with GU cancer detection with longitudinal analysis.We discovered that histidine, propylene glycol, valine, leucine, acetylsalicylate, glycine, isoleucine, succinic acid, lysine2-aminobutyric acid and acetic acid are involved significantly in the all types of the male patients. We did not findanystatistically significanceinurine biomarkers between female and male patients.However, a statistically insignificantcorrelation was found among the grade and stage with the metabolites.The urine metabolomic profiles of the GU tumors and the control group are distinct. The urine metabolites of the male patients of the upper tract urothelialcarcinoma(UTUC) were found statistically significance compared with the control.
